About East Ryde
East Ryde is a compact residential suburb in the City of Ryde, situated on Sydney's Northern Suburbs approximately 12 kilometres north-west of the CBD. With a population of 2,522 and a median age of 43, it is an established, mature community predominantly made up of families and long-term residents. The suburb covers just over one square kilometre at around 45 metres elevation, featuring a mix of detached family homes, semi-detached dwellings, and some apartment development typical of the Ryde area.
East Ryde sits within easy reach of the West Ryde town centre and the Ryde CBD, offering a range of shopping, dining, and services for daily needs. The suburb is well served by bus routes connecting to West Ryde station on the T1 North Shore and Western Lines, providing rail access to Sydney CBD in around 30 minutes, while Pittwater Road and Victoria Road offer solid car connectivity. Local parks and sporting ovals contribute to a family-oriented lifestyle, and the suburb's diverse heritage — reflecting English, Irish, Chinese, and Italian ancestry — adds to its community richness.
East Ryde falls under postcode 2113 and is governed by Ryde Council (LGA). For state elections, residents vote in the Lane Cove electorate.
